Where in the World will Roger & Rafa get ready for the Australian Open?

January 2, 2011 By grandslamgal

While writing the previous article about which men’s tennis players are playing where in Australia in the January lead up to the Australian Open, the names Rafael Nadal and Roger Federer were noticeably absent.

Both Roger and Rafa are confirmed to play in Doha in January at the Qatar ExxonMobil Tennis Open from 3 to 8 January.

Checking out their schedules on their websites, neither Roger nor Rafa are playing in any tournaments in Australia until the Australian Open.

Once the Doha tournament finishes on 8 January, and until the Australian Open starts on 17 January, where will Roger and Rafa go for their training?

Will Roger hang out at his place in Dubai, spending some time with Mirka and the twins between training sessions?

What about Rafa?

Eight days is a long time in the tennis calendar. If it was the lead up to Wimbledon, he could have pretty much won the final of Queens and then gone back to Mallorca for a mini break in that time.

Maybe he and Uncle Tony will hire a huge house in Toorak with a private tennis court and big fence?

Until we see both boys, springy and fresh and ready to slam at the Australian Open, where in the world will they be in January?
